The number of child labour has risen to 160 million worldwide

International Labour Organization (ILO) and UNICEF releaved a report that shows the number of children in child labour has risen to 160 million worldwide – an increase of 8.4 million children in the last four years. famine crisis in northern ethiopia

New data from the World Food Programme (WFP) confirmed the magnitude of the hunger emergency gripping Tigray, where at least 4 million people face severe hunger and 350,000 of them are facing famine. Dusty Journey Near Mount Nemrut, Turkey

The inhabitants of the Kıyıdüzü village in Tatvan district of Bitlis, Turkey make their living by raising sheep and goats. They pass through the dusty road every day in plateau where they reside from spring to autumn. “Ring Of Fire” Appears In The Sky

The northern hemisphere witnessed the first solar eclipse of the year. The eclipse called the “Ring of Fire” as the Moon did not cover the Sun completely. Caddebostan Coast Cleans-Up Marine Mucilage

Turkish Minister of Environment and Urbanization Murat Kurum launched a clean-up campaign against marine mucilage in Caddebostan and other provinces in the Marmara Sea on Tuesday. While mucilage continues in the provinces bordering the Marmara Sea, Caddebostan coast is cleaned up on the third day of campaign.
